Forklift came as part of the March 2012 MacUpdate Bundle, and has FTP as just 
one of a myriad things it can do. Some of its powers will remain puzzling to 
many users, but they include more accessible wonders like Folder 
Synchronisation, browsing the contents of archive files (eg, zip, rar, etc), 
split and combine large files, batch renaming, and many others. $0.99 seems an 
incredible price for this package.
